> Considering the log, I have checked the /lib/modules/ directory in
> my OE
> and it seems the version is "oe/tmp/rootfs/lib/modules/2.6.24-rc3"
> and I
> guess maybe the problem is the mismatch between the version of Linux
> kernel from Xilinx and OE. IF it is the reason, what should be the
> solution?
>
I've seen a similar error message, when building a higher version
linux-omap3 recipe, say linux-omap3-2.6.31, and then do a bitbake
clear linux-omap3-2.6.31 and build a lower version of the linux-
omap3-2.6.29 and create the rootfs, after disabling the linux-
omap3-2.6.31 recipe.
The net result is that when the rootfs gets built, the /lib/modules
folder contains files from both the v2.6.31 and v2.6.29 recipes, and
give me the same version mismatch error message that you're seeing
right now.
The solution is to completely delete you OE tmp folder and rebuild
again, ensuring that only a single version of the recipe gets built.
